The physical quantities not having same dimensions are
-
torque and work
-
momentum and Planck's constant
-
stress and Young's modulus
-
speed and $\left(\mu_0 \varepsilon_0\right)^{-1 / 2}$
Solution
$[$ momentum $]=[\mathrm{M}][\mathrm{L}]\left[\mathrm{T}^{-1}\right]=\left[\mathrm{MLT}^{-1}\right]$
(Planck's Constant) $=\frac{E}{\mathrm{u}}=\frac{[\mathrm{M}]\left[\mathrm{LT}^{-1}\right]^2}{\mathrm{~T}^{-1}}=\mathrm{ML}^2 \mathrm{~T}^{-1}$
